Handover — Vexler partner SFTP drop

Ownership moves to you today. Drop runs hourly from Vexler's end into the intake bucket via the relay host. Watch for zero-byte files; their exporter flakes on Mondays. Creds live in the ops vault, path noted in the runbook. Vault auto-seals after 48h idle. Support escalations go to the on-call rotation, not me. If the vault is sealed when you need it, unseal with the recovery passphrase below.

recovery phrase for tadug-fafof: zorwyn-kasion

/*
 * Firmware update channel constants for the Oakspur device fleet.
 *
 * New folks: devices poll the Bramleth update service on a staggered
 * schedule so we never wake the whole fleet at once. A rollout moves
 * through rings (canary, early, general), and each ring must bake for
 * a minimum window before promotion. If failure telemetry crosses the
 * abort threshold, the channel freezes automatically. Changing any of
 * these values requires sign-off from the fleet-health rotation. The
 * current values are defined below.
 */

tuning constants:
BUDGETS = {
    "druath": 240,
    "lamwyn": 180,
    "silael": 275,
}

TURN-208: Gatevale turnstile counters at the Merrow Field pilot double-count when a rotation reverses mid-cycle. Attendance totals drift roughly 2% high per event. The debounce window fix is implemented, reviewed by Ilsa, and soak-tested across two simulated match days without drift. Ready for your cut; the candidate build is identified below.

trace token, tagag-tafog: htk6_5ed18c